E-student. Normal harvest time for my area (which is actually 100 miles north of where my map shows it as I haven't changed it since moving) is W. Barley - late July/Early August, Canola - Early to mid August, S. Barley/W.Oats - Mid to late August, W. Wheat - Mid August to Mid september. This year we started the Canola on 15th August and finished the wheat about the 20th of September but would have been finished 2 weeks earlier if it hadn't rained. Average yields this year were, Canola 3t/ha, S. Barley 5.5t/ha and wheat 8t/ha.
Matts, the OSR was sown about the 20th of August and had pre emergence weed control with Butisan and Centium and 30kgN/Ha.
The 9070 has had a few teething problems but they are going to sort them out over winter, good output and low losses, except when the straw is wet and the grain is 40%, I didn't stay out long that day!
At the moment we have 2 Claas tractors an Axion 830 which is about 195hp and a Celtis 456 which is 100hp.
